228 conditional help

Zhao Yuanle put down his book and walked over.

She clearly saw Sister Man'er at this time. She was much thinner than when they first met, her eyes were much darker, her face looked much whiter, and she had lost her energy.

When she saw Zhao Yuanle coming over, she smiled hard.

But she really couldn't laugh anymore.

"Are you OK?"

Zhao Yuanle: "I'm fine."

Sister Man'er was a little worried: "That guard, I remember, he didn't make things difficult for you, right?"

Zhao Yuanle: "He is fine."

Sister Man'er nodded.

She asked Zhao Yuanle: "Is it because you spoke for me that he let me go without asking for money?"

Zhao Yuanle smiled and said nothing.

Sister Man'er took out a wrapped handkerchief from her pocket, which probably contained some copper plates.

She pushed the handkerchief in front of Zhao Yuanle.

"You have helped me time and time again. Now that I have lost my home, I am too embarrassed to go to your house to find you. If you don't mind, just use this little money to buy something to eat."

Zhao Yuanle didn't answer. She looked at Sister Man'er with sympathy.

"Is it because your house was burned down? I didn't know about it before. If I knew..."

Sister Man'er interrupted her with a wry smile.

"It doesn't matter whether it's a fever or not. With me as an old gambler, I can never see the end of my life.

Alas, I am finished.

I originally thought that if I made more money, I would at least support my two younger brothers, but in the end, both my younger brothers were burned. Fortunately, it was nothing serious, but I couldn’t miss the medicine.

The hospital is already cheap enough, and the doctor even paid for it for me.

Who knew that my old gambler still had gambling debts outside?

Me too…"

As she said this, Sister Maner started to swallow even more.

She knew that she had now fallen to the lowest level.

She was even too embarrassed to go to Zhao Yuanle's house to look for him, so she only dared to wait here.

At this moment, Zhao Yuanle looked at Sister Man'er and couldn't say any more comforting words.

Sister Man'er blinked hard and held back her tears.

"Forget it, this is my life."

She thought that if she worked hard and tired, she might be able to survive after getting married, but now, this hope has been shattered.

She just waited for her two brothers to be able to support themselves, so she went to find a rope and hanged them in the ruined temple, and rolled up a piece of rotten mat to settle the bill.

Zhao Yuanle looked at Sister Man'er, whose eyes were full of dusk in front of her, and reached out to push back her handkerchief.

"I do not want."

Sister Man'er was stunned and smiled awkwardly.

"I...Actually, this money was earned by me before. It's clean, not that kind of..."

Zhao Yuanle stopped her.

"That was not what I meant."

Sister Man'er held the handkerchief, her nose twitched, and she looked at Zhao Yuanle like this.

Zhao Yuanle: "Actually, that security guard didn't let you go just because of my face."

Sister Maner was confused.

Zhao Yuanle: "You had to pay a silver dollar before leaving. I paid it for you, so he let you go."

When Sister Man'er heard this, her mouth opened in fright.

"You, why did you give him so much money, a silver dollar, you..."

Zhao Yuanle smiled.

"Do you think I feel heartbroken? I want to tell you that a silver dollar is nothing to me now.

I can help you.

In two months at most, my family will be raising a lot of pigs. When the manpower is insufficient, we will definitely need help, and I can let you do the work."

Sister Man'er listened to Zhao Yuanle's words and waited for the next step.

Here comes the following.

Zhao Yuanle: "But!"

Sister Man'er lifted her spirits.

Zhao Yuanle: "But if you want others to help you, you have to save yourself first. I can give you a job, or I can lend you urgently needed money first.

But you have an old man who is a gambler in your family. He clings to you and sucks your blood. How can I safely lend you money and give you a job?

When the time comes, I’ll be pissed off if you post it to your old gambler again?”

Sister Man'er thought about Zhao Yuanle's words and slowly said: "So..."

Zhao Yuanle: "So, within two months, you must show me your determination. During this time, you have to get rid of your old gambler. You have to think of the method you want to use."

After two months, if I see that you can stop sucking your blood from your gambling old man, I will give you a job as a child and help you advance your brother's medical expenses."

Sister Man'er fell silent, her eyes gradually becoming solemn.

She asked Zhao Yuanle: "How can I avoid being sucked by my gambling old man?"

Zhao Yuanle thought for a while and said: "It's very simple. If you can keep your money and prevent it from being taken away by your old gambling man in other ways, it is proof."

Sister Man'er smiled bitterly.

Where does she have money?

At this time, Zhao Yuanle took out two silver coins and put them in Sister Man'er's hand.

"Two silver coins are enough for your urgent needs. I will come to see you in two months. If you can still return these two silver coins to me, that will prove it."

Zhao Yuanle is somewhat clearer about the mentality of a gambler.

Such people, for the sake of gambling money, will not recognize their relatives and will do whatever it takes.

She gave Sister Man'er these two silver coins, and Sister Man'er will definitely use them for urgent needs now. As soon as Sister Man'er uses the money, her old man who is a gambler will know about it, and he will definitely try every means to steal the money.

If the money was robbed, it would prove that Sister Man'er still compromised with her old man even though her two brothers had to spend money to buy medicine.

Then she doesn't need to help her, just treat these two silver coins as a act of kindness.

If she could keep the money, she wouldn't have to worry about Sister Man'er, an old gambler, and she would be able to help.

In fact, Zhao Yuanle has thought about it, even if Sister Man'er doesn't have two silver dollars in the future, it will be fine.

As long as she doesn't continue to do the flesh business, it can be known that she has resisted her gambling father.

After listening to Zhao Yuanle's words, Sister Man'er looked at the two silver coins in her hand and finally couldn't help but shed tears.

"How lucky am I to meet such a good person like you, my sister?"

She never thought that a person with no relatives or friends would be willing to help her like this.

When she was at her most desperate, there was no one she could rely on around her. There were only two poor younger brothers in the family, and her father who stole money and went out to gamble and drink.

It was too late for the other relatives to hide, so no one would come closer to her.

These days, when she was forced to do this, those people began to spit on her, call her a pheasant, and step on her one by one to show how superior they were.

She wanted to hang herself several times, but she couldn't worry about her two younger brothers.

Now…

Sister Man'er's eyes became firm, she raised her head, looked straight at Zhao Yuanle, stretched out three fingers and swore to the sky.

"I, Zhou Man'er, swear that I will return these two silver coins to you in two months' time, and I will straighten out my old gambling man.
